MES Hosts 2nd All Assam Inter-School Yogasana Championship

Staff Reporter, Guwahati: Modern English School, Kahilipara, Guwahati, successfully hosted the 2nd All Assam Inter-School Yogasana Championship 2025, uniting over 120 young yoga enthusiasts from across the state in a spirited display of flexibility, focus, and discipline. Organised by the Modern School of Languages, Sports, and Performing Arts, the event drew participation from more than 20 schools across Assam. Students competed in the Traditional Yoga category, judged by an esteemed panel from Yogasana Bharat and the Universal Yoga Sports Federation, including Suresh Poddar, Dipankar Nath, Suranjan Debnath, and others. Participants were assessed on performance, stability, intensity, expression, and overall presentation. The competition was divided into sub-junior and junior categories across age groups 5 to 19 years. Among the winners, Sabir Rahman (Aastha Fitness Academy) and Rajashree Purakasta (Namah Yog Studio) topped the Sub-Junior Group A (5–8 years), while Bornil Pratim Sharma and Sanggy Das stood out in Junior Group A (13–15 years). In the senior-most Junior Group B (16–19 years), Harjeet Singh (South Point School) and Kuhi Deka (St. Mary’s Senior Secondary) claimed the first positions in their respective categories. Principal Jonali Das remarked, “It is an honour to host this prestigious event. Yogasana fosters not just physical health, but also mental discipline and emotional strength.” Yoga Coach Dr. Saiful Islam added, “Yoga is a way of life. Events like these sow the seeds of mindfulness and balance in our youth.” The championship concluded with a grand prize distribution ceremony, where winners were awarded trophies and certificates. The event highlighted Assam’s growing commitment to nurturing wellness and holistic education among students.
